The document outlines a Daily Lesson Log for Grade 12 Practical Research 2, focusing on data collection procedures and skills over four sessions. It includes objectives, content standards, learning resources, and detailed procedures for teaching students how to gather and analyze data using various instruments. The lesson emphasizes ethical considerations in research and culminates in students creating their own survey questionnaires.
